Genesis 13:10-11 New International Version (NIV)
10 Lot looked around and saw that the whole plain of the Jordan toward Zoar was well watered, like the garden of the Lord, like the land of Egypt. (This was before the Lord destroyed Sodom and Gomorrah.) 11 So Lot chose for himself the whole plain of the Jordan and set out toward the east. The two men parted company:
Our character can be revealed in our choices. Lot’s character was revealed by his choices. He took the best land. He chose to live near a city known for its sin. He was greedy and wanted the best for himself. He did not think of his uncle, Abram. He chose not to be fair. Life puts choices in front of us. You can choose.
